Wild ducks There are many kinds of wild ducks in Honghu Lake, which generally refer to wild waterfowl such as Anseriformes, Craneformes, Phytophthora and Trichodermaformes. There are 396 species, belonging to 8 orders and 9 families. They are divided into blue-headed ducks, yellow ducks, medium ducks, and eight-tower ducks. They go from spring to autumn every year and can be caught in winter and spring. Pu ducks, black ducks, etc. have adapted to the climatic conditions here and have settled down, so they can be hunted all year round. Honghu wild ducks can hunt hundreds or even thousands at a time, with an annual output of more than 250,000 kilograms, accounting for more than half of Shenzhen Province's wild duck production, with the highest annual output reaching more than 400,000 kilograms. Regarding wild ducks and wild geese, there is a saying among the people in Honghu that "nine wild geese and eighteen ducks are the best, but Qingtou and Bata are the best." Honghu wild ducks represented by "Qingtou" and "Eight Towers" can be said to be full of treasures. Using its body meat as a dish, Honghu braised wild duck has a history of more than 200 years and was selected into the "Chinese Recipe". Honghu wild duck can also be refined into medicine. Soft-shell turtle, whose scientific name is soft-shelled turtle, is also called turtle, belongs to the class Reptile and belongs to the family Soft-shelled Turtle. Turtles are usually olive-colored, usually 24 centimeters long and 16 centimeters wide, and live in rivers, lakes, and ponds. Honghu Lake is a water-rich area, with lakes dotted all over the area, luxuriant aquatic plants, and dense concentrations of fish, shrimps, and snails. It is a natural place for soft-shell turtles to survive and breed. The turtles produced are large and fat, and although they can be caught all year round, they are still in short supply in domestic and foreign markets. Honghu soft-shell turtle has high edible and medicinal value. Turtle meat has extremely high nutritional value and is a delicacy at banquets.
